Beautiful location. The tent at the Spoonbill site was amazing and had everything you need. The most comfortable bed I’ve ever slept in. The pellet heater was easy to use and had perfect temperature. The massive bathtub is a huge plus. A perfect little getaway that doesn’t feel touristy and so close to Tathra and Bermagui. Fair warning that there’s a mouse that made its mission in life to get into the tent every night, but did not succeed. The toilet broke temporarily but was fixed within 30 minutes of texting the owners. I didn’t see a single other guest or hear them, perfectly quiet. The kangaroos are so friendly and the birds always singing. Is overpriced at $300 a night but would recommend anyway.

The location and surrounding national park at Tanja was really beautiful which deserves a 5 star rating. The safari tent and bathroom/kitchenette setup was also beautifully done which deserves a 4 star rating. The 2 star rating is because; (1) there was no hot water for the first 24hours then when we did have hot water there was no water pressure; (2) the cleanliness was questionable; (3) owners were obviously busy with renovations and liked to blame other customers for showing us to our tent and for not having gas for hot water; (4) the walk to the beach was beautiful but took longer was stated in the book and I had six leaches on me when I got back; (4) it is so over priced.
